The Supreme Court has just ruled for the state of South Carolina in a lawsuit over the state booting Planned Parenthood from participation in Medicaid.
Specifically, this was a lawsuit about whether Medicaid beneficiaries in South Carolina, aka Planned Parenthood, have the right to sue the state to enforce the “free-choice-of-provider” provision in the Medicaid Act.
The high court ruled by a margin of 6-3 they don’t have that right and can’t sue:
